Sizes game
Sizes game is a game developed for children where they can learn the difference in the sizes of objects in a fun way from their mobile phone, tablet or computer.
game developed by:
Nau.kids
Sizes game is a game developed for children where they can learn the difference in the sizes of objects in a fun way from their mobile phone, tablet or computer.
game developed by:
Nau.kids
Game Instructions: Sizes game Edition
Drag the object of the correct size.
